5 / 22 page 5 FN8174.3 June 23, 2011 PIN DESCRIPTIONS Bus Interface Pins SERIAL OUTPUT (SO) The Serial Output (SO) is the serial data output pin. During a read cycle, data is shifted out on this pin. Data is clocked out by the falling edge of the serial clock. SERIAL INPUT (SI) The Serial Input (SI) is the serial data input pin. All operational codes, byte addresses, and data to be written to the potentiometers and potentiometer registers are input on this pin. Data is latched by the rising edge of the serial clock. SERIAL CLOCK (SCK) The Serial Clock (SCK) input is used to clock data into and out of the X9271. HOLD (HOLD) HOLD is used in conjunction with the CS pin to select the device. Once the part is selected and a serial sequence is under way, HOLD may be used to pause the serial communication with the controller without resetting the serial sequence. To pause, HOLD must be brought LOW while SCK is LOW. To resume communication, HOLD is brought HIGH, again while SCK is LOW. If the pause feature is not used, HOLD should be held HIGH at all times. CMOS level input. DEVICE ADDRESS (A1 - A0) The Device Address (A1 - A0) inputs are used to set the 8-bit slave address. A match in the slave address serial data stream must be made with the address input in order to initiate communication with the X9271. CHIP SELECT (CS) When Chip Select (CS) is HIGH, the X9271 is deselected, the SO pin is at high impedance, and (unless an internal write cycle is under way) the device is in standby state. CS LOW enables the X9271, placing it in the active power mode. It should be noted that after a power-up, a HIGH to LOW transition on CS is required prior to the start of any operation. Potentiometer Pins RH, RL The RH and RL pins are equivalent to the terminal connections on a mechanical potentiometer. RW The wiper pin (RW) is equivalent to the wiper terminal of a mechanical potentiometer. Supply Pins SYSTEM SUPPLY VOLTAGE (VCC) AND SUPPLY GROUND (VSS) The System Supply Voltage (VCC) pin is the system supply voltage. The Supply Ground (VSS) pin is the system ground. Other Pins HARDWARE WRITE PROTECT INPUT (WP) The Hardware Write Protect Input (WP) pin, when LOW, prevents nonvolatile writes to the data registers. NO CONNECT No Connect pins should be left floating. These pins are used for Intersil manufacturing and testing purposes. X9271 |
